                            H.R. No. 336


 R E S O L U T I O N
 WHEREAS, Shelley Snyder is retiring from the YMCA of
 Metropolitan Fort Worth in 2015, drawing to a close a distinguished
 career in which she has provided outstanding service to that
 organization and to the young people of Fort Worth; and
 WHEREAS, Ms. Snyder first joined the staff of the YMCA 28
 years ago, and she has been with the Fort Worth YMCA for nearly a
 quarter century; during her exemplary tenure, she has served as
 vice president of operations and has played an essential role in the
 organization's efforts; and
 WHEREAS, In addition to her other responsibilities,
 Ms. Snyder has devoted 15 years to overseeing Fort Worth Youth and
 Government; more than 4,500 individuals have taken part in this
 youth-led, experiential initiative that is designed to increase
 their understanding of civic affairs and to help them become
 responsible citizens; under Ms. Snyder's leadership, the District
 IV program has fielded 10 Youth Governors and has expanded to
 include middle school and home school students; and
 WHEREAS, In recognition of her achievements, Ms. Snyder
 received the Bill Theiss Award at the Youth and Government State
 Conference; this prestigious honor is presented to a YMCA staff
 member who has made important contributions to the program at the
 local and state levels; and
 WHEREAS, Shelley Snyder's conscientiousness,
 professionalism, and unwavering commitment to the mission and
 values of the YMCA have earned her the admiration of her coworkers
 and the gratitude of countless youth, and she may reflect with pride
 on a job well done as she embarks on the next exciting chapter of her
 life; now, therefore, be it
 R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 84th Texas
 Legislature hereby congratulate Shelley Snyder on her retirement
 from the YMCA of Metropolitan Fort Worth and extend to her sincere
 best wishes for continued happiness and success in all her
 endeavors; and, be it further
 R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be
 prepared for Ms. Snyder as an expression of high regard by the Texas
 House of Representatives.
